.New Form of Lost-Wax Casting

Traditional lost-wax casting requires preliminary work where craftsmen manually sculpt wax molds based on planar diagrams, with repeated communication and refinements, before proceeding to mold making. If structural changes are needed during this process, it takes even more time and steps. Nowadays, more and more people are using 3D printing for prototyping, which can be completed within a day or even hours, right within the company. You can even compare the physical 3D printed model with other assembly parts and perform simple tests. If modifications are needed, you only need to adjust the 3D drawing and print again, then directly proceed to the metal casting step.

.Two Technologies, a Perfect Match: Layer-Free and Ash-Free


.Layer-Free Technology:
Place the PolyCast 3D printed part in a misty alcohol vapor environment. The entire process will be automatically completed in the Polysher alcohol polisher. This principle works by using a rapidly vibrating "nebulizer" inside the alcohol polisher to generate alcohol vapor. When the surface texture of the 3D printed product absorbs alcohol particles, a chemical change occurs, making the surface smooth, glossy, and polished (further reading: 3D Printing Polishing Time-lapse Video).



.Ash-Free Technology:
When PolyCast filament is used for lost-wax casting, it burns cleanly without leaving any residue. These clean molds can be used to create flawless metal parts. This technology has led to increasing applications of 3D printing in lost-wax casting, significantly reducing the high costs and production time previously associated with CNC machining or mold manufacturing for small batches of metal parts.
